Sarah "Sallay" Whitney 1776–1858 – Genealogical Records

Birth Date: 1776

Birth Location: Raymond, Cumberland, Maine, USA

Death Date: 30 Dec 1858

Death Location: Casco, Cumberland, Maine, USA

Father: Moses Whitney

Mother: Sarah Garey

Spouse(s):

Children(s): Daniel Cook

In 1776, Sarah "Sallay" Whitney entered the world in Raymond, Cumberland, Maine, USA, born to Moses Whitney And Sarah Garey. Sarah "Sallay" Whitney had children including Daniel Cook. Sarah "Sallay" Whitney passed away in 1858 in Casco, Cumberland, Maine, USA.
